Juan Pablo Zapaterio, Entered everlasting rest on August 11, 2023, in New York City.
Juan Pablo was born on June 23, 1986, in Cartagena, Colombia. He was named after Pope John Paul II. He moved to West New York at the age of nine and lived there until 2020. Graduated from Memorial High School and obtained his Bachelor degree in Art Education with a minor in Art History at Kean University in 2010 and his Master’s in Fine Arts/Ceramics at New Jersey City University in 2016 later returning to teach at his devoted former High School.
A resident of Fairview New Jersey at the time of his passing. He will be survived by his mothers Clara Zapateiro and Aura Erazo, his two sisters Aura Victoria Vargas Zapateiro and Zoila Rosa Vargas Zapateiro, his two nephews Andres Hernandez and Mauricio Otero and his faithful dogs Ushki and Jack.
Juan loved spending time with his friends and family at his home backyard growing fruits and vegetables. Juan's love for learning transmuted into exciting traveling adventures which allowed him to broaden his teachings and his students to perceive learning as cool and fun.
He will be remembered by all of extended family members, friends, colleagues, former and recent students, and specially by all of those that he touched with his love and unique personality.
As we grieve the loss of this Angel, we take comfort in knowing that he will live forever in the lives he saved unselfishly. That his infectious personality will remain attached to all of those who knew him. And his commitment to teaching love through art will encourage his students to brighten the world that surrounds us.
